The ThumbForge queue accepts render jobs via POST to the enqueue endpoint and processes them in priority order across the Larkspur worker pool. If jobs stall, first check the dead-letter topic before restarting workers, since restarts reset retry counters. All administrative operations, including requeue and purge, require authenticated requests. When paging through stuck jobs during an incident, include the bearer token provided below.

login token, kagaf-bawig: eyJhbGciOiJIUzI1NiIsInR5cCI6IkpXVCJ9.eyJzdWIiOiI1b8bmcIn0.xjc0uBP3

## Onboarding — Markdown Pipeline (Inkmere)

Inkmere docs render through a three-stage pipeline: parse, sanitize, emit. Releases rebuild all templates; never hot-patch emitted HTML. Broken renders usually mean a sanitizer rule change — check the rules diff first. The render cluster only accepts builds from the release channel, and every build artifact must be signed before upload. Sign artifacts with the deploy key below.

release key, hafop-tajef: bky13_s2vaFVNJTHfBL

## DedupeBot Env Vars

Quick refresher for the sync: DedupeBot merges customer records nightly, and it keeps choking because staging is missing its config. Set MERGE_BATCH_SIZE=500 and DEDUPE_STRICT_MODE=true in your .env before running locally, or you'll get false merges like the Harlow incident. One more thing: the matcher service won't authenticate without its token, so add this line right after the flags above.

secret setting of fawep-tagaf: ARCHIVE_KEY3=ce5

Ticket: Staging env misconfigured for Siftgate bloom filter

The bloom layer in front of the Pellet KV store is rejecting all lookups in staging because the env file was copied from the dev template without credentials. False-positive tuning values are fine; only the auth line is missing. To unblock the weekly demo, the Pellet admission secret must be set on the following line.

env line for yaguf-fajop: LEDGER_TOKEN13=fb08984397349